Output 51db15761cb6af9314bca7dac2f16db6031b57155bf20926f52faf3ca7b0903f:0

value
17595259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a2addc4723a71f4a929fbc5f2a954f516e0ce11 OP_EQUAL
address
3CpyiMA2wfRhLnQTj1TFVjKdnPghk4tFUY
transaction
51db15761cb6af9314bca7dac2f16db6031b57155bf20926f52faf3ca7b0903f
spent
true